预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于自适应遗传算法的无线多媒体传感器网络WMSNs的QoS路由算法 基于自适应遗传算法的无线多媒体传感器网络WMSNs的QoS路由算法 摘要:无线多媒体传感器网络(WMSNs)是一种由大量分布式传感器节点组成的网络,用于收集、处理和传输多媒体数据。在WMSNs中,实现高质量服务(QoS)的路由是一个重要的问题。传统的路由算法很难满足WMSNs中多样化的QoS需求。为了解决这个问题,本文提出了一种基于自适应遗传算法的QoS路由算法,该算法能够根据网络状态动态调整路由路径,以确保传输的多媒体数据能够满足用户的要求。 关键词:无线多媒体传感器网络,QoS,路由算法,自适应遗传算法 1.引言 无线多媒体传感器网络(WMSNs)是一种新兴的网络技术,具有广泛的应用前景,例如环境监测、智能农业等。WMSNs通过大量分布式传感器节点来实现对环境中各种数据的收集、处理和传输。然而,由于WMSNs中的传感器节点具有资源限制和不可靠的无线信道,高质量服务的实现成为一个挑战。 实现高质量服务(QoS)的路由是WMSNs中的一个核心问题。传统的路由算法通常采用传统的启发式方法,例如最短路径算法等,但这些算法往往无法满足WMSNs中多样化的QoS需求。因此,本文提出了一种基于自适应遗传算法的QoS路由算法,该算法能够根据网络状态动态调整路由路径,以确保传输的多媒体数据能够满足用户的要求。 2.相关工作 近年来,研究者们提出了许多QoS路由算法,以满足WMSNs中多样化的QoS需求。其中,遗传算法被广泛应用于解决路由问题,并取得了良好的效果。遗传算法是一种模拟自然进化过程的优化方法,通过选择、交叉和变异等操作来搜索问题的最优解。然而,传统的遗传算法往往具有适应度函数难以定义、优化速度慢等缺点。因此,本文提出了一种基于自适应遗传算法的QoS路由算法。 3.算法设计 本文提出的基于自适应遗传算法的QoS路由算法分为两个阶段:初始化阶段和优化阶段。 3.1初始化阶段 在初始化阶段,算法首先生成一组初始解作为种群,每个解表示一个可能的路由路径。然后,根据每个解的适应度函数值,对种群中的解进行排序。接下来,通过选择和交叉操作,生成下一代的种群。 3.2优化阶段 在优化阶段,算法根据当前网络状态动态调整路由路径。具体来说,算法根据网络中传感器节点的能量水平、拥塞情况和时延要求等因素,调整各个解的适应度函数值。然后,再次对种群中的解进行排序,并生成下一代的种群。这个过程循环进行,直到达到停止条件。 4.实验与评估 本文通过在模拟环境中进行实验,评估了提出的算法的性能。实验结果表明,相比于传统的启发式方法和传统的遗传算法,提出的算法在满足QoS需求和提高网络吞吐量方面取得了较好的性能。 5.结论 本文提出了一种基于自适应遗传算法的QoS路由算法,用于解决无线多媒体传感器网络中的QoS路由问题。通过在实验中的评估,该算法在满足QoS需求和提高网络吞吐量方面表现出了较好的性能。未来的工作可以进一步研究算法的可扩展性和适应性,以适应不同的网络环境。